Well I strongly recommend AGAINST installing the holder on the handlebar upside down like in this video. I did that and dropped my iPhone while riding my bike; ended up with a busted phone and had to buy a new one.
The problem is that the attachment does not always lock, but it will still hold in place until you hit a bump, and if the direction is downwards you drop the phone on the street.
Having said that it's still the best bike mount I've found so far.
